Police are crediting a quick-thinking Uber driver for bringing a toddler to safety after he found the child wandering alone in the city’s Scarborough Village neighbourhood early Thursday morning.

Police say the two-year-old boy was found barefoot outside, wearing only a diaper and T-shirt, in the area of Markham Road and Cougar Court at around 3 a.m.“It was about six degrees last night so quite cold. We don't believe the child had been out too, too long. He was in very good health and good shape,” Toronto police Supt. David Ridzik said on Thursday.

“The mother has not been interviewed but found out the information that the child had been located and contacted us right away and obviously was a little distraught,” Ridzik said.“They will look into the circumstances and try to find out and determine exactly what happened,” Ridzik said. He noted that it is the third time in the last few weeks that a taxi driver has assisted police in locating a missing person.
